ORLANDO, Fla. – Massey Services announced the opening of three new commercial service centers in North Carolina, Tennessee, and Texas.
The new service centers in Charlotte, N.C., and Chattanooga, Tenn., are the company’s first commercial locations in each state. The Charlotte service center will provide pest and termite services to commercial customers in both North Carolina and South Carolina. The Chattanooga Service Center will provide pest and termite services to businesses throughout the eastern portion of Tennessee.
In Texas, the new Austin Commercial Service Center joins an established network of eight commercial service centers in the state. The new location in Austin will service commercial customers throughout the city of Austin as well as Leander and Round Rock.
“Our new service centers in Austin, Charlotte, and Chattanooga represent our commitment to meeting the needs of our business customers in these growing markets,” said Tony Massey, president and CEO of Massey Services. “These new dedicated commercial offices will provide a business-focused expertise that includes adapting to our customer’s hours of operations, access points and layout to minimally interfere with normal operations. As always, we are dedicated to delivering exceptional customer satisfaction and these new service centers enable us to respond within two hours of a customer request. We look forward to continued growth in all three of these markets.”
